The factors that made me choose ITM are good placement opportunities and 5 months of summer Internship and the bad aspects are intake , they take more students every year The admission process consists of Pi and Case test I prepared by going through their website and connecting with alumini
I choose Marketing course, Marketing has great future and also has very good opportunities Faculty are well qualified, many faculty have PhD Exams are conducted according to the time and the difficulty level of the exam is moderate The fees are 10,20,000 and the college hostel should be paid separately which is 90,000 per year There will be scholarship tests conducted by the college, they offer 100% free if you score well, and there are many financial institutions connected with the college so you can get loan facilities easily
I got an internship in Digicore and the role that they offered is Sales and the stipend that they provide is 10000 per month the internship is for 5 months. My task is to Call clients and make them agree to take digital marketing services
The placement opportunities for every student The main companies that visit are Deloitte, ICICI, Federal Bank, Mahindra and Mahindra, Hafele, and many other big companies Deloitte took 25 students ICICI recruited 16 and many companies took a good number of students The highest package is 21 lakhs and the average is 7 lakhs 100% of students get placed I got placement
There are many fests conducted on the ITM campus, There is UFEST which is conducted every year There is also a Business chappal which will help students to learn sales and marketing There are also marketing activities conducted in the college There will be Flashmob All the festivals are celebrated very well in campus, especially Ganesh Chaturthi
